With the formation of multi-infeed HVDC, the difficulty of security and stability control of the system increases. Serious ac/dc fault occurs, the commutation failure in multi-circuit HVDC power transmission system will bring the system risk of losing stability, therefore avoiding commutation failure in HVDC power transmission system and maintaining voltage stability of receiving end power grid, are currently important problems that receiving end power grid takes control measures need to be solved. The power grid characteristics of multi-infeed HVDC and influence factors that lead to communication failure are analyzed, and the control strategy of voltage instability that formation of multi-infeed HVDC leads to is put forward in the sight of the three defense lines. Based on the simulation of the actual power grid, the proposed control strategy can effectively reduce the risk of commutation failure in multi-circuit HVDC and improve the voltage stability level of receiving end power grid.
